Ticket TL-442: The staging instance of Chronoplan, our school timetable solver, was deployed with the production solver queue credentials. This means staging runs can enqueue jobs against live district schedules at Hollowbrook Academy. We need to rotate the affected credential and point staging at its own queue. For the security review, note that the fix requires updating the staging .env with the following line:

vault entry, tagug-hahip: ARCHIVE_KEY3=e34

Hi all, and welcome aboard to our new contractor joining the Loamfield team. The PedalShift rebalancing tool now computes dock-to-dock transfer plans using the updated demand model, and the candidate has passed both the simulation suite and the overnight soak test against the Brinmore dataset. Please review the migration notes before deploying, as the planner config format changed. If anything looks off, hold the rollout and ping the channel. The candidate build for verification is listed below.

session token of tajef-bageg = htk21_5d90d574934f3ccae6437

Subject: DR drill Thursday — SQL lint repo

On-call: Thursday's drill simulates loss of the Ferrowick lint service. The SQL linting rules repo will be restored from cold backup. Your job: verify rule checksums, re-run the migration lint suite, confirm CI goes green. Restore console is sealed until drill start. Unseal it with the recovery passphrase below.

strongbox words: sorir-belvan-rusix-ulays-ralmir-praix-eliir-tamax-praael-druael-julir-tamius-jorir

## 3.2.0 — Changed defaults

EchoHall audio-guide app: default playback bitrate lowered for gallery Wi-Fi, offline cache pruning now enabled out of the box, and autoplay on beacon proximity is off by default. No API changes; review focus should be the new fallback order for narration languages. New installs now start with the following defaults.

settings of yageg-yahap:
[gorael]
team = olieth
access_code = ac_941d74
owner = brieth.aldiel
host = gorael.tolvaqio.internal
port = 6379
peer = briwyn.urlaqtech.internal
salt = 116e6622
pin = 1957